The Monte-Carlo Masters marks the unofficial start to tennis' European clay-court swing, with the sport's biggest names descending on the Monte-Carlo Country Club in Roquebrune-Cap-Martin, France from 4–12 April.

Defending champion and world No. 1 Carlos Alcaraz headlines a field that includes 2026 Sunshine Double winner Jannik Sinner and three-time Monte-Carlo champion Stefanos Tsitsipas.

All times are local to the event.

Saturday 4 April – Qualifying, from 11:00 a.m. (14 matches)

Sunday 5 April – Qualifying and first round, from 11:00 a.m. (13 matches)

Monday 6 April – First round, from 11:00 a.m. (17 matches)

Tuesday 7 April – First and second rounds, from 11:00 a.m. (16 matches)

Wednesday 8 April – Second and third rounds, from 11:00 a.m. (17 matches)

Thursday 9 April – Third round, from 11:00 a.m. (12 matches)

Friday 10 April – Quarter-finals, from 11:00 a.m. (8 matches)

Saturday 11 April – Semi-finals; first singles not before 1:30 p.m., second singles not before 3:30 p.m. (4 matches)

Sunday 12 April – Finals; doubles final at 12:00 p.m., singles final at 3:00 p.m.
